    Default Natural cough remedies

    For the last couple of weeks I have had a terrible cough. I went to the GP who told me that I had had the flu and that the cough was going to go on for a while now. I seem to be quite OK during the day but each morning I wake up with a hacking cough and then each evening when I lie down it starts again, goes off a bit and then recently I have been waking up in the night coughing...I have never smoked although to hear me you would think I was on 60 a day!!!
    If anybody knows of anything particularly soothing I would be really grateful.

    Dear Auntie, I am sorry to hear you have been so ill. I do sympathise as I have had something similar. I coughed so much I almost vomited a few times. I bruised my chest and stomach muscles badly.
    It was made worse as I had builders in my home for weeks and the dust got everywhere.
    I suggest you get some olbas oil and put it in an aromatherapy burner with water, also put some menthol crystals in. Keep it on as much as you can and the vapour will help you breathe.
    There are some generic cough medicines which will not have been tested on animals, but I am not sure if you would want those.
    If you have a temperature you could choose to take paracetamol, it will bring it down.
    A soothing drink can be made by boiling water, adding lemon juice, sugar or apple concentrate, and ginger, drink as much of this as you can.
    Spicy food with chilli in such as curry will clear the snot off your lungs and help you breathe.
    If you start coughing up snot with blood in, or brown or green snot, go back to the doctor. If your snot is clear, you are on the mend.

    white horehound is a pretty good throat/cough remedy as far as i can remember - consult a herbalist first though or health food store for stock of some ready made lozenges??


    yes essential oils are good, try a little of eucalyptus in a burner for general airways healing...or lavender which is gentler....try a drop of tea tree or euc or lav in a bowl of boiling water and inhale with a towel over your head?
